Uses the ATP from the light reactions Takes place is the stroma of the chloroplast (outside the thylakoid, inside the chloroplast). 3 steps: 1. carbon fixation, 2. reduction 3. regeneration ALSO KNOWN AS DARK REACTIONS
8
Carbon fixation ◦ The enzyme RuBisCo combines the 5- Carbon compound RuBP with carbon dioxide (CO 2 ) to make an unstable 6 carbon compound
9
Reduction: The unstable 6 carbon compound is split apart and reduced into 2 molecules with 3 Carbons, called G3P ◦ Requires ATP and NADPH
10
Regeneration: A large array of enzymes rearrange 5 G3P molecules into 3 RuBP molecules, which start off the Calvin cycle ATP required 1 G3P can be taken out of the cycle every 3 turns, to go toward making glucose
11
1 carbon dioxide is fixed per turn of the cycle Each turn takes 3 ATP and 2 NADPH, made in the light reactions (lots of energy!) To make one glucose, it takes six turns of the cycle
